Abstract

In the first part of the article, the author compares various definitions of digital economy and spells out his own version of its essence and content. He defines digital economy as one of the models of new economy based on digital technology system. The author believes that digital technology system consists of various technologies, such as Big Data, high-speed wireless Internet, blockchain, cloud computing, Internet of things, artificial intelligence, 3D printing, virtual reality and others. The second part examines the current state of development of digital economy in various sectors of the economy and notes that the development of digital economy is led by the telecommunications industry, followed by the financial sector. The author emphasizes the need to develop a specific state policy to support the development of digital economy and suggests some ways to further expand it.
